comparison src/server.c @ 136:4e91b92f91a7

[gaim-migrate @ 146] Added event_back and event_buddy_back events. committer: Tailor Script <tailor@pidgin.im>
author Eric Warmenhoven <eric@warmenhoven.org>
date Wed, 19 Apr 2000 07:57:20 +0000
parents 890cfb7d8fdb
children 41bd1cd48571
comparison
equal deleted inserted replaced
135:e9852a08f9c6 136:4e91b92f91a7
626 626
627 } 627 }
628 628
629 b->idle = idle; 629 b->idle = idle;
630 b->evil = evil; 630 b->evil = evil;
631 #ifdef GAIM_PLUGINS
632 if ((b->uc & UC_UNAVAILABLE) && !(type & UC_UNAVAILABLE)) {
633 GList *c = callbacks;
634 struct gaim_callback *g;
635 void (*function)(char *, void *);
636 while (c) {
637 g = (struct gaim_callback *)c->data;
638 if (g->event == event_buddy_back &&
639 g->function != NULL) {
640 function = g->function;
641 (*function)(b->name, g->data);
642 }
643 c = c->next;
644 }
645 }
646 #endif
631 b->uc = type; 647 b->uc = type;
632 648
633 b->signon = signon; 649 b->signon = signon;
634 650
635 if (loggedin) { 651 if (loggedin) {